- STUDY ON THE EVALUATION OF CROSS VENTILATION PERFORMANCE OF DETACHED HOUSE BY EFFECTIVE AIR CHANGE RATE AND EFFECTIVE OPENING AREA OF WINDOWS RATIO

抄録
The effect of improving indoor environment by the cross ventilation, the rate to discharge thermal energy by the ventilation is larger than the reduction effects of SET* by indoor air flow. In this study, the relationship between the difference of indoor temperature and outdoor temperature by the effect of ventilation will be less than 1°C and the opening area of windows ratio are calculated for a simple and the standerd AIJ detached house model. The relationship between the air change rate, opening area of windows conditions and cross ventilation performance of the house is clarified.<br>The results are as follows; <br>(1) When air change rate is 20 times/h, the inside air temperature becomes nearly equal to the outside air temperature due to the discharge thermal energy by the ventilation. <br>(2) The opening area of windows ratio tends to be high in the inland, and it tends to be low in the city along the sea in Japan. <br>(3) Results of standard AIJ detached house model, the opening area of windows ratio with which ventilation rate is 20 times/h becomes a low value of feasibility. The opening area of windows ratio with which ventilation rate is 10 times/h becomes a values that may be realized.
